  2. Taylor Brennan Washington (born August 16, 1993) is an American professional soccer player who plays as a defender for Major League Soccer club Nashville SC . Career. Youth and college. Washington was born in New York where he played youth soccer for FC Somers and FC Westchester, MLS Next.

  3. Taylor, Washington. Coordinates: 47°25′08″N 121°54′20″W. Taylor is a ghost town in King County, in the U.S. state of Washington. [1] History. Taylor was laid out in 1893 as a company town by the Denny Clay Company after a railway was built in the area in 1892.

  7. Mar 14, 2023 · Taylor Washington has waited a long time for his first goal in Major League Soccer. Now 29, Washington was drafted by the Philadelphia Union in 2016, but never played in an MLS match. Washington signed for Nashville SC in December 2017, among the first handful of professional players to sign with the club.
